AI Smart Mushroom Chamber Developed by SJKT Pulau Carey Barat Earns Silver Medal at ITEX’24

In a remarkable display of innovation and technological prowess, Sekolah Jenis Kebangsaan (Tamil) Pulau Carey Barat’s students clinched the silver medal at the prestigious 35th International Invention, Innovation, Technology Competition & Exhibition Malaysia (ITEX’24). Held from May 16th to 18th, 2024, at the Kuala Lumpur Convention Centre, this annual event showcases cutting-edge inventions from across Asia and beyond.

Under the mentorship of Mrs. Vasagai Gandan and the guidance of School Headmaster Mr. Stevan Antonysamy, five exceptional students Rubesh Kumaran, Sai Kavesh Saravanan, Thanosini Kamala Kannan, Kavilashini Vailmurugan, and Kirtika Kunasegaran crafted an AI Smart Mushroom Chamber.

This innovative chamber integrates artificial intelligence with advanced sensor technology to optimize mushroom cultivation conditions, ensuring consistent and enhanced yields. Notably, this invention not only addresses existing challenges in traditional mushroom farming but also heralds a new era of technology-driven, sustainable agriculture, particularly benefiting B40 farmers and promoting increased food production at smaller scales.

The significance of this achievement resonates beyond the confines of the competition arena. Mrs. Vasagai Gandan emphasized the motivational impact on students, stating, “Seeing students succeed on an international stage will motivate other students to pursue their own projects and participate in competitions. The winning team members will serve as role models, demonstrating that hard work, creativity, and perseverance can lead to significant accomplishments.”

Moreover, both the teacher and the headmaster expressed gratitude for the exposure gained through ITEX’24. “We were exposed to a wide array of innovative projects from around the world. This broadened our understanding of how different cultures and perspectives approach problem-solving.

The competition pushed us to enhance our technical and soft skills. From advanced prototyping and coding to public speaking and teamwork, we grew significantly in various areas,” shared the teacher and headmaster. Both the teacher and the headmaster appreciated the school management (PIBG) and parents for their tremendous help.

ITEX’24 witnessed the presentation of over 700 inventions, technologies, and products from more than 15 countries, illustrating the global impact and reach of innovative initiatives. Sekolah Jenis Kebangsaan (Tamil) Pulau Carey Barat’s consistent participation in such competitions underscores its commitment to nurturing a culture of innovation and excellence among its students. In 2022, this school got a gold medal as well as the Taiwan special award at (ITEX 22).

As the world grapples with multifaceted challenges, the success of initiatives like the AI Smart Mushroom Chamber serves as a beacon of hope, showcasing the transformative power of education, creativity, and technology in shaping a brighter, more sustainable future. Throughout the years, the school has actively sent students to numerous innovation and invention competitions.
